The Narrow Way - Dr. R. C. Sproul

The sermon confronts the cultural assumption of universal salvation by emphasizing Jesus' teaching that the way to eternal life is narrow and few find it, contrasting this with the broad, destructive path that many follow. Drawing from Luke 13 and the Sermon on the Mount, it underscores the urgency of spiritual striving, warning that divine mercy is not guaranteed and that the door to salvation will eventually close, leaving even those who claim familiarity with Christ excluded if they lack genuine faith. The preacher highlights the tragic reality of human resistance to God, not due to inability, but because of a will that refuses Christ, illustrating the paradox of free will and divine sovereignty.
